What is phlebotomy? And to whom does this suit?

Phlebotomy is basically the practice of drawing blood from veins either for diagnostic purpose or for collection. They play vital role to maintain the hospital environment. Owing to the advancements in the health care field, there may be a myriad of diagnostic tools but blood test always occupies its own place. This profession best suits the personality that remains unaffected on seeing blood. There should be no phobia over watching blood. For one who is aspiring to become a phlebotomist must take this point into consideration.

Choosing the right school

Take heed to select the right phlebotomy school. Only schools that are accredited by the national certifying agencies must be opted. Only from an accredited training school you will be able to sit for the certification exam.

Final step!!- obtaining certificate

After finishing the training program one may apply for certification. As most employers are on a look out for Certified Phlebotomists it is always advantageous to do a number of certification though it is not a compulsion in the state of Utah.

How much can you earn?

The phlebotomist in the state of Utah can earn around $26,000 on an average. The phlebotomists in the state of Utah are offered with a number of other benefits. Salt Lake City, Logan, Tooele, Murray are some of the cities where one can locate potential employers. One can also check out phlebotomy training in Nevada.
